Funnefoss/Vormsund Idrettslag ("Fu/Vo") is a Norwegian sports club from Nes, Akershus. It has sections for association football and amateur boxing.

It was founded as a merger between Funnefoss IF and Vormsund IL. Funnefoss IF was founded on 6 December 1924, and Fu/Vo counts this as their founding date.[2] Funnefoss was a member of the Workers' Sport Confederation for a short time.[3] The merger took place on 5 February 1967.[2] It covers the villages Funnefoss, Oppåkermoen and Vormsund in Nes, and the home ground is at Oppåkermoen.

The men's football team currently plays in the Third Division, the fourth tier of football in Norway. Its current stint started in 2002, after several years on lower levels.[2]
